U.S. citizens are in order to shell out taxes on all incomes made in foreign places. The proceeds are to be included in their income taxation assessments and vital taxes will be paid. However, for incomes that are taxed on the foreign countries, taxpayers may include a tax credit equivalent to the taxes paid but on the limit on the taxes which may be have been paid if for example the taxable income was designed domestically. For citizens that reside abroad, the IRS provides a tax free waiver for that first $92,900 earned in the year 2011.

In 2003 the JGTRRA, or Jobs and Growth Tax Relief Reconciliation Act, was passed, expanding the 10% tax bracket and accelerating some of your changes passed in the 2001 EGTRRA.
